About

I’m Eliza, a event photographer, based on the south coast of England. I have always had a passion for all things creative and find events and concerts a way to escape from daily reality. Leading to me capturing the amazing events and creative outputs along the south coast. I love creating photos capturing the small snapshots of people’s lives.

Known for capturing the essence and atmosphere of events, while also focusing on the smaller details, I’ve had the pleasure of working with a wide variety of clients in the arts and corporate events.

I studied photography at Arts University Bournemouth and graduated in 2024 with a first class honours degree.
